Key Specifications to Consider When Selecting Terminal Lugs

When selecting terminal lugs, understanding key specifications is essential. Materials play a major role in performance. Copper and aluminum are the most common choices. Copper offers excellent conductivity, while aluminum is lightweight and cost-effective. Consider the operating environment. Corrosive or high-temperature settings require specific finishes. Coatings, such as tin or nickel, enhance durability.

The size of the terminal lug is another critical element. Ensure a proper fit for the wire gauge. A mismatch can lead to overheating and failure. Additionally, the crimping process must be precise. Poor crimping can create weak connections. Always use the correct tools for crimping.

Finally, look into the certification and testing standards. Reliable manufacturers adhere to rigorous quality tests. This assures that the lugs meet industry standards for safety and efficiency. Comparative Analysis of Terminal Lug Materials and Their Performance

Terminal lugs are crucial for ensuring reliable electrical connections in various applications. The choice of materials significantly influences their performance. Reports from industry experts highlight copper and aluminum as the most common materials. Copper lugs provide superior conductivity, which is vital in high-current scenarios. Interestingly, copper's conductivity is approximately 60% higher than that of aluminum, making it a preferred choice in critical applications.

However, aluminum lugs have their advantages. They are lighter and often more cost-effective. Recent studies show that aluminum lags are increasingly used in industries focusing on reducing weight without compromising performance. Yet, potential issues arise with corrosion, particularly in outdoor environments. This has led to debates on whether the initial savings outweigh the possible long-term maintenance costs.
